Stewart Monti Brings Medieval Courage to Life in Hillary and Sir Edward

Stewart Monti invites readers into a richly imagined world of 12th century England with his latest release, Hillary and Sir Edward, a compelling historical tale that challenges tradition and celebrates courage, identity, and possibility.

Set during the reign of King Henry II, the story follows Hillary, a 13-year-old girl whose life defies expectations. Raised by her father, Jacob, a skilled blacksmith trained in swordsmanship, Hillary develops remarkable abilities uncommon for girls of her time. She excels in swordplay, chess, and horsemanship, all while maintaining her grace and individuality. Her journey takes a pivotal turn when Sir Edward, a trusted family friend, arrives in search of a page, setting the stage for a question that challenges the norms of medieval society. Can a young girl rise to a role traditionally reserved for boys?

Hillary and Sir Edward is more than a historical narrative. It is a story of determination and belief in one’s own potential. With vivid storytelling and engaging characters, Monti weaves a tale that encourages readers to look beyond limitations imposed by society and embrace their unique strengths. The book builds upon the foundation of his earlier work, Mary and Sir Edward, continuing the legacy of characters whose lives are shaped by resilience and unexpected turns.

The inspiration behind the book stems from Monti’s earlier narrative and its evolution into a screenplay that explored the future of its characters. This creative process led to the development of Hillary’s story, offering readers a deeper and more complete continuation of the original narrative.

At its heart, the book delivers a powerful and timeless message. There is never anything you cannot do. This theme resonates strongly throughout Hillary’s journey as she challenges expectations and redefines what is possible in her world.

Stewart Monti’s work appeals to readers who enjoy historical fiction with strong character development and meaningful themes. His storytelling captures both the spirit of the medieval era and the universal desire to overcome obstacles and pursue one’s purpose.
